How On’s Captured-Carbon CleanCloud Midsole Launch At On Holding (ONON) Has Changed Its Investment Story

In July 2026, Infinium announced it is supplying its waste CO₂- and renewable hydrogen-based eNaphtha to Borouge International and On, enabling the commercial launch of On’s CleanCloud technology in the Cloud X 5, the first commercially scaled sportswear midsole made from captured carbon emissions. How Hasbro’s Adult-Focused Blooms by Play-Doh Launch Could Shape Hasbro (HAS) Investors’ View

Earlier this month, Hasbro launched Blooms by Play-Doh, an adult-focused line that turns its classic compound into realistic, preserved floral arrangements priced from US$24.99, complete with tools, vases, and a finishing spray. The move extends Play-Doh into adult crafting and home décor, aligning the brand with rising demand for hands-on, stress-relief activities among Gen Z and Millennials. Will Brazil Entry and Localized Scents Strategy Change Bath & Body Works' (BBWI) Global Growth Narrative?

Earlier this month, Bath & Body Works entered Brazil through its first store and digital platform, tailoring its fragrance assortment to local preferences for fruity and tropical scents while extending its Viva collection inspired by Brazilian culture. This move adds Brazil to the company’s more than 550 international locations across six continents and over 45 countries, underscoring how its franchise-partner model and localized product curation underpin its global expansion approach.
